Things to consider before hiring an intern

Hiring an intern can sound like a win-win situation; the intern gets an opportunity to learn and boost their career, you get some extra help generally at a lower wage rate than regular employees. However, it is important to first think about if an intern would be right for your company before you make the commitment. Ask yourself why you need an intern:If you’re looking for an intern for a short-term solution to help with your daily tasks, think about if it would really be the best solution before putting up a job ad. Hiring an intern also means that they should be trained and monitored, which also takes up resources and time. Additionally, interns nowadays often want to do more than admin tasks such as getting coffee. A good internship usually means that the intern gets industry experience and mentorship. Consider remuneration:If an intern is hired in accordance with the law, then they do not always require compensation. Think about what kind of tasks they would do, how much they would work and their academic and professional experience to help you decide on appropriate remuneration.
